The Book of Indian Reptiles and Amphibians
Author : J. C. Daniel,Bombay Natural History Society
Publisher : Oxford University Press, USA
Page : 238 pages
File Size : 44,7 Mb
Release : 2002
Category : Nature
ISBN : 0195660994
The Book of Indian Reptiles and Amphibians by J. C. Daniel,Bombay Natural History Society Pdf
This new title covers the curious world of reptiles and amphibians, both common and rare, found in the Indian faunal limits. There has been no book to rival J C Daniel's earlier Book of Indian Reptiles, also published by the Bombay Natural History Society in 1983. He has now presented an entirely new text of not only a large number of reptiles, but has also described frogs, toads, and other amphibians, a much neglected group that is revealed in this book as picturesque, and biologically interesting as any other group of animals. This book contains field observations and photographs, and descriptions of 175 species including 53 snakes, 45 lizards of various groups, 31 tortoises and turtles, and 45 amphibians. Almost each species has been illustrated with the line drawings, photographs and reproductions of paintings from the Journal of the BNHS. The book satisfies professional zoologists, amateur naturalists, students and the interested general reader alike. There is a reference section with reptiles and amphibians listed separately. Photographic contributions from several members of the BNHS, add contemporary appeal to this exciting new field guide, which also contains snippets of historical information.
A Key to Amphibians and Reptiles of the Continental United States and Canada
Author : Robert Powell,Joseph T. Collins,Errol D. Hooper
Publisher : Lawrence, Kansas : University Press of Kansas
Page : 144 pages
File Size : 49,9 Mb
Release : 1998
Category : Nature
ISBN : MINN:31951D01655662C
A Key to Amphibians and Reptiles of the Continental United States and Canada by Robert Powell,Joseph T. Collins,Errol D. Hooper Pdf
A dichotomous key (that is, one that gives the user only two choices at each level of morphological scrutiny), it is designed for use in college-level herpetology or vertebrate biology courses. It will be especially useful as an effective tool for teaching the principles of taxonomy and for introducing students to the systematics of amphibians and reptiles.

Field Guide to Amphibians and Reptiles of Illinois
Author : Christopher A. Phillips,John A. Crawford,Andrew R. Kuhns
Publisher : University of Illinois Press
Page : 304 pages
File Size : 44,7 Mb
Release : 2022-06-28
Category : Nature
ISBN : 9780252053252
Field Guide to Amphibians and Reptiles of Illinois by Christopher A. Phillips,John A. Crawford,Andrew R. Kuhns Pdf
The second edition of the Field Guide to Amphibians and Reptiles of Illinois offers up-to-date information on the state’s 102 species of frogs and toads, salamanders, turtles, lizards, and snakes. Detailed descriptions by the authors include habitats, distinguishing features, behaviors, and other facts, while revised range maps and full-color photographs help users recognize animals in the field. In addition, an identification key and easy-to-navigate page layouts guide readers through extensive background material on each species' population, diet, predators, reproduction, and conservation status. A one-of-a-kind resource, the Field Guide to Amphibians and Reptiles of Illinois is a definitive guide aimed at biologists, teachers, students, wildlife specialists, natural resource managers, conservationists, law enforcement officials, landowners, hobbyists, and everyone else eager to explore herpetology and nature in the Prairie State.
